Hardwood Floor Removal in Conroe, TX

Hardwood floor removal services involve the careful and efficient process of taking out existing hardwood flooring materials from a property. This service is commonly requested during renovation projects, flooring upgrades, or when preparing a space for new flooring installation.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of removal, including whether the existing flooring can be salvaged or if it will need to be disposed of, as well as any potential impact on the subfloor or underlying structure. Clear communication about the process helps ensure that the project aligns with renovation goals and minimizes disruptions to the property.

Before requesting hardwood floor removal, homeowners should consider the type of flooring being removed, such as solid hardwood, engineered wood, or laminate, as each may require different techniques. It’s also helpful to know if there are any adhesives, nails, or other fasteners involved, which can affect the complexity of removal. Property owners often want to understand the potential for dust, debris, and noise during the process, as well as the disposal options for the old flooring materials. Having this information in advance helps ensure a smooth and efficient removal process that fits the overall renovation plan.

FAQ

Hardwood Floor Removal Questions

What types of flooring can be removed? Hardwood floor removal typically covers solid and engineered hardwoods, including various finishes and styles commonly used in residential and commercial spaces.

Is hardwood floor removal messy? The process may produce dust and debris, but proper containment and cleanup methods help minimize disruption during removal projects.

Can hardwood floors be removed without damaging the subfloor? Yes, careful removal techniques are used to preserve the subfloor when possible, especially if it is in good condition.

What are common reasons for removing hardwood floors? Floors may be removed to replace damaged wood, update the look of a space, or prepare a surface for new flooring installation.
